杭州抖音SEO优化报价与服务价格深度解析
〖One〗、In the digital marketing landscape of Hangzhou, where e-commerce and tech innovation converge, the question of “杭州抖音SEO优化报价” has become a central concern for businesses striving to capture a larger share of the local, national, and even international markets. Unlike traditional search engine optimization which focuses on Baidu or Google, Douyin (TikTok’s Chinese counterpart) SEO is a specialized field that optimizes a brand’s presence within the platform’s highly dynamic, algorithm-driven ecosystem. The pricing structure for such services in Hangzhou is far from monolithic; it is a sophisticated matrix that reflects the unique demands of the local market, which is home to some of China’s most competitive consumer goods and service industries. Typically, a basic monetized package might start around 3,000 to 8,000 RMB per month, which covers fundamental keyword research, account setup optimization, and basic content distribution. However, this entry-level tier is often insufficient for businesses seeking substantial organic growth, especially in saturated sectors like luxury goods, live-streaming e-commerce, or local food services. Mid-range packages, ranging from 10,000 to 30,000 RMB monthly, usually involve more granular analysis—including competitor benchmarking, trending audio integration, and the strategic use of hashtag chains. These packages often come with monthly reports focusing on metrics like video completion rate, comment sentiment, and profile visit conversion rates. For enterprises requiring a full-scale domination strategy, premium services can exceed 50,000 RMB per month, featuring AI-driven content optimization tools, influencer cross-promotion management, and real-time algorithm adjustment mechanisms. It is crucial to understand that these quotes are not arbitrary; they are heavily influenced by the client’s current account health, the competitiveness of their target keywords (e.g., “Hangzhou silk,” “Xihu longjing tea quick delivery”), and the desired speed of ranking improvement. Consequently, local service providers in Hangzhou, ranging from boutique SEO agencies to large digital marketing firms, will typically require an in-depth assessment of a business’s unique profile before issuing a final, actionable quote.
〖Two〗、The variance in “杭州抖音SEO服务价格” can be attributed to several core factors that distinguish a basic optimization effort from a comprehensive, data-driven campaign. Firstly, the scope of work is a primary determinant. A basic service might only involve optimizing a verified business account’s profile bio, cover image, and video descriptions with high-volume keywords like “杭州美食” or “杭州探店.” In contrast, a mid-to-high-level service delves into technical SEO aspects, such as optimizing video titles for platform-specific search algorithms, creating structured data for content recommendation systems, and building a cohesive content cluster around a niche topic. For instance, an upscale restaurant in West Lake district wouldn’t just target “杭州西湖区餐厅”; they would need a cluster of videos targeting “西湖龙井宴,” “杭州高端商务包厢,” and “杭州夜景餐厅c位,” each optimized with precise timing and audience cues. Secondly, the quality and frequency of content production play a massive role in pricing. Many agencies include content creation in their bundles, where the cost of hiring local video editors, scriptwriters, and even on-camera talent can significantly inflate the monthly fee. A package that promises daily or thrice-weekly high-definition, scripted videos with professional-grade editing will naturally cost more than one that leverages user-generated content or repurposed material. Thirdly, the level of analytics and reporting transparency offered is a key price differentiator. Basic plans may provide only superficial metrics like likes and shares, whereas premium services might offer heat maps of viewer attention, sentiment analysis of comments using NLP tools, and A/B testing for different video hooks and posting times—all tailored to the specific behavior of Hangzhou’s Gen-Z and millennial demographics. Furthermore, the inclusion of paid promotion management (e.g., Douyin+) within an SEO package is another cost driver. While SEO focuses on organic reach, a synergistic approach that mixes organic optimization with minimal paid traffic to kickstart algorithmic visibility is a popular strategy in Hangzhou’s competitive business environment, thus reflecting in the overall quote. Lastly, the reputation and track record of the agency itself introduce a premium. A well-known Hangzhou-based digital agency with proven cases of ranking high for competitive local keywords like “杭州装修公司排名” or “杭州抖音代运营” will command higher prices than a freelance operator, as they bring trust, established relationships with local KOLs, and a tested methodology.
〖Three〗、To effectively navigate and negotiate the “杭州抖音SEO优化报价” landscape, businesses must adopt a strategic approach that aligns their budget with tangible, measurable outcomes rather than just service descriptions. The first step is to define a clear set of KPIs (Key Performance Indicators) that go beyond vanity metrics. For a local flower shop in Hangzhou, a successful SEO campaign might be measured by the number of direct DMs (private messages) per week, the click-through rate from the video’s “shopping bag” link to their local ordering page, and the increase in foot traffic to their physical store. When evaluating a provider’s pricing, ask specific questions: Does the service include regular refinement of negative keywords (e.g., filtering out traffic from non-local audiences) Does the package cover the optimization of the account’s “附近的人” (Nearby People) feature, which is critical for physical store locations Customization is paramount. Avoid blanket packages. Instead, request a modular quote that separates the cost of keyword research, content creation, account optimization, and performance tracking. This allows for flexibility—you might choose to do in-house content creation while outsourcing the high-level technical analysis. Another vital consideration is the contract’s flexibility. Many agencies in Hangzhou will push for a 3- or 6-month minimum contract, citing the “learning period” of the algorithm. While this is partially true for Douyin’s ever-evolving AI, ensure that the agreement includes milestones (e.g., reaching a top-20 ranking for three primary keywords or achieving a 10% increase in profile visits by the end of month two). A common trap is paying for “SEO” that is actually just optimized posting without any real algorithmic intervention. Demand a clear explanation of how the provider’s methodology differs from standard content uploading. For instance, a legitimate SEO service will reverse-engineer the ranking factors for specific search queries in Hangzhou, such as the importance of video completion rates for food-related keywords or the role of user comments for service-based search terms like “杭州上门维修.” Finally, remember that the cheapest quote is often the most expensive in terms of missed opportunities. A low-cost package might rank you for irrelevant keywords or provide generic advice that works for a national brand but fails in the specific context of Hangzhou’s hyper-local, fierce competition. Conversely, an overly expensive package without a transparent success metric can be a drain on resources. The sweet spot is a mid-range, fully transparent service that offers tiered pricing based on performance benchmarks, with clear clauses for both early termination and reinvestment into more aggressive strategies if initial organic growth is promising. By treating the investment as a continuous experiment rather than a one-time purchase, businesses can leverage Hangzhou’s unique digital ecosystem to build sustainable brand authority through strategic, algorithm-compliant SEO practices.
